Output fb72ea95c79bbf0c1b362fabb2932f302eb9e88601c1d5ebdf98a4edee8800d6:3

value
391246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3db148a789af0a7c1763c543d8b0cf65b8b05217 OP_EQUALVERIFY OP_CHECKSIG
address
16dCbbbY5BeDnNBDw5Rtt4j2pYCUVTE6qV
transaction
fb72ea95c79bbf0c1b362fabb2932f302eb9e88601c1d5ebdf98a4edee8800d6
confirmations
289487
spent
true